Lindbergh: The Life of the "Lone Eagle" in … Nettet-Expert Fact 1: Charles Lindbergh lived from 1902 to 1974. He completed the first solo nonstop flight across the Atlantic Ocean in 1927. Fact 2: Lindbergh was nicknamed "Lucky Lindy" and "The Lone Eagle." Fact 3:Lindbergh was a Pulitzer Prize winner, but not for "WE." His second autobiography, "The Spirit of St. Louis" won in 1953. NettetWhen Charles A. Lindbergh, made the first flight across the Atlantic to Paris, he was soaring into history. The amazing journey made him the most famous man in America, if not the entire world. His solo achievement was prelude to a life of accomplishment, triumph and tragedy witnessed by millions through the lens of his celebrity, which he ...
